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
156 661 4009928701 32259
6475 61 7859627
6475 61 7859627
75479041921 26842170300 0469
All about undefined
Interested in learning more?
6475 61 7859627
75479041921 26842170300 0469
See more
92732178 62307189 49323883884
030 4750643192 9353039821
See more
1474450 48386249 0876690
408 87 30968
See more